MINI MAC & CHEESE BITES
Young relatives were coming for a Christmas party, so I wanted something fun for them to eat. Instead, the adults devoured my mini mac and cheese. -Kate Mainiero, Elizaville, New York

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 425°. Cook macaroni according to package directions; drain., Meanwhile, sprinkle 1/4 cup bread crumbs into 36 greased mini-muffin cups. In a large saucepan, melt butter over medium heat. Stir in flour and seasonings until smooth; gradually whisk in milk. Bring to a boil, stirring constantly; cook and stir 1-2 minutes or until thickened. Stir in 1 cup cheddar cheese and Swiss cheese until melted., Remove from heat; stir in biscuit mix, eggs and 1/2 cup bread crumbs. Add macaroni; toss to coat. Spoon about 2 tablespoons macaroni mixture into prepared mini-muffin cups; sprinkle with remaining cheddar cheese and bread crumbs., Bake 8-10 minutes or until golden brown. Cool in pans 5 minutes before serving.

KIDS CAN MAKE: MAC 'N' CHEESE BITES
We miniaturized our kids' favorite meal into party-sized poppers. For big and little kids: Let them help measure the ingredients, stir them together and fill the muffin liners. You can make the snacks a day in advance, and warm them up at 350 degrees F for about 5 minutes.

Steps:
- Position oven racks in the upper and lower thirds of the oven, and preheat to 400 degrees F. Line 2 or 3 mini-muffin pans with liners, and coat the liners generously with cooking spray.
- Bring a medium pot of salted water to a boil. Add the macaroni and cook according to the package directions until al dente. Drain the macaroni and rinse under cold water until cool. Drain again and shake off any excess water.
- Put the heavy cream, cream cheese, eggs, mustard, paprika and garlic in a large bowl. Beat on low speed with an electric mixer until combined (the mixture may have small lumps). Add the macaroni, Cheddar and Monterey jack, and stir until combined.
- Drop heaping tablespoonfuls of the mac 'n' cheese into the prepared muffin liners. Combine the breadcrumbs and butter with your fingers in a small bowl until the mixture is the texture of wet sand. Sprinkle the top of each mac 'n' cheese mound with the buttered breadcrumbs.
- Bake until the cheese is melted and the bites are golden brown, 25 to 30 minutes. Let cool for at least 5 minutes before serving hot or at room temperature. Serve with hot sauce on the side, if desired.
MAC 'N' CHEESE BITES
Catering for guests with different diets or tastes? These mac 'n' cheese bites are ideal party food. From mushrooms to olives, top with whatever you like

Steps:
- To make the toppings, heat half the oil in a frying pan over a high heat, and cook the mushrooms for 10 mins until golden. Stir in half the garlic and the parsley, and fry for 1 min more. Season and scrape into a bowl. Heat the rest of the oil in the pan and fry the remaining garlic and the breadcrumbs for 3-5 mins, stirring until crisp. Scrape into a second bowl.
- Melt the butter in a saucepan over a medium heat, then stir in the flour to make a thick paste. Gradually add the milk, a splash at a time, whisking until it's all incorporated. Cook for 2-3 mins more until thickened. Meanwhile, cook the macaroni in a pan of boiling salted water for 5-6 mins. Stir the cheddar into the white sauce until all the cheese has melted, then fold in the macaroni.
- Butter a 12-hole muffin tin and divide the mac 'n' cheese between the holes, packing it in with the back of a spoon. Top with the mushroom mixture, olives or sundried tomato slices, then scatter over the grated cheese and garlic breadcrumbs. Will keep, covered in the fridge, for up to 24 hrs.
- Heat the oven to 220C/200C fan/gas 7. Bake for 15 mins until golden and piping hot. Leave to cool for 10-15 mins in the tin, then loosen by running a spoon around the edges. Transfer to a plate.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400ºF (200°C) with a 12-cup nonstick muffin tin inside.
- Make the McCormick® chili: Heat the canola oil in a large pan over medium-high heat. Add the onion and sauté until the onion is translucent, 3-5 minutes.
- Add the ground beef and cook, stirring with a wooden spoon to break up the beef, for 5-7 minutes, until the meat is browned.
- Drain any excess fat from the meat mixture, then add the McCormick® Chili Seasoning and water. Mix and cook for another 4-5 minutes, until the spices are well incorporated. Remove the pan from the heat.
- Make the mac 'n' cheese: Melt the butter in a medium saucepan over medium-high heat. Add the flour and cook, stirring frequently to break up any clumps, for 5 minutes, or until the roux is light golden brown. Reduce the heat to medium. Slowly pour in the milk and cook, whisking constantly, until thickened, about 8 minutes. Do not let the mixture come to a boil.
- Turn off the heat, then add 1½ cups shredded cheddar cheese and the salt. Whisk until the cheese is melted and well incorporated. Add the cooked macaroni to the cheese sauce and stir with a wooden spoon until the noodles are well coated.
- Add the chili to the mac 'n' cheese and stir until well incorporated.
- Carefully remove the hot muffin tin from the oven and grease with nonstick spray.
- Sprinkle a heaping tablespoon of shredded cheddar cheese into each cup.
- Fill each cup with the chili mac 'n' cheese, pressing down slightly with the back of a spoon to flatten the tops.
- Place the muffin tin on a baking sheet, then bake for 15-20 minutes or until the sides of the mac 'n' cheese cups are bubbling. Remove from the oven and let cool for at least 20 minutes to set up.
- Using a plastic knife to avoid scratching the muffin tin, loosen around the edges of each chili mac 'n' cheese bite. Then remove from the pan. If the cups are falling apart, let cool for another 10 minutes.
- Top the chili mac 'n' cheese bites with sour cream, shredded cheddar cheese, scallions, and jalapeño slices, if desired.

EASY MACARONI AND CHEESE BITES APPETIZER
Yum! These mac and cheese bites are cheesy, crispy, and delicious. The mix of Monterey Jack and cheddar cheeses makes these bites nice and cheesy. We recommend adding the Dijon mustard, it gives a slight tang to the bites. Smoky bacon is the perfect topping. By coating the tins with bread crumbs, they really do come out easy but...

Steps:
- 1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ees and grease mini muffin tin generously with butter or non-stick spray.
- 2. Coat insides of mini-muffin tin with bread crumbs (to help the bites hold their shape).
- 3. Bring large pot of lightly salted water to a boil and add macaroni. Cook 4-5 minutes, just until softened but not cooked through. Remove from heat, drain and return to pot.
- 4. Stir in butter and egg until pasta is evenly coated.
- 5. Mix in bacon, mustard, milk, salt, and cheeses (reserving 1 cup Jack cheese).
- 6. Then spoon into muffin tin, press filling gently with fingers (to help the bites hold their shape). Top with reserved cheese.
- 7. Bake 15-20 minutes or until top is golden brown.
- 8. Allow muffins to cool slightly before removing from pan. Garnish with parsley and enjoy.
